How to Reach Rann Utsav From Delhi

Traveling from Delhi to Rann Utsav (Tent City, Dhordo) is easy and can be done by flight, train, or road. The nearest major city is Bhuj, located about 80 km from the festival site.

1. Delhi to Rann Utsav by Flight (Fastest Option)

  • The nearest airport is Bhuj Airport (BHJ).
  • There are direct and connecting flights from Delhi to Bhuj, operated by airlines such as IndiGo, Air India, and SpiceJet.
  • Flight duration: 2 hrs (direct) / 4–5 hrs (connecting).
  • From Bhuj Airport, you can reach Rann Utsav by:
    • Private taxi (80 km – 1.5 hours)
    • Pre-arranged tour vehicle
    • Resort/Tent City pick-up service

2. Delhi to Rann Utsav by Train

  • The nearest railway station is Bhuj Junction (BHUJ).
  • Popular trains from Delhi:
    • Ala Hazrat Express
    • Bhuj AC Superfast Express
    • Delhi Sarai Rohilla–Bhuj Express
  • Train duration: 18–20 hours.
  • From Bhuj railway station, take a taxi or join your tour package vehicle to reach Dhordo.

White desert view

3. Delhi to Rann Utsav by Road (For Road-Trip Lovers)

  • Total distance: ~1,200 km
  • Travel duration: 20–22 hours
  • Best highway route:
    Delhi → Jaipur → Ajmer → Udaipur → Ahmedabad → Bhuj → DhordoYou can self-drive or hire a Delhi to Rann Utsav taxi for a smooth journey.

Activities to Enjoy at Rann Utsav

  • White Desert visit during sunset & night
  • Cultural folk dance & music
  • Camel cart ride
  • Local handicraft shopping
  • Traditional Kutchi food experience
  • Adventure sports (paramotoring, ATV ride, cycling)
  • Visit: Kalo Dungar, Mandvi Beach, Bhuj sightseeing

Best Time to Visit Rann Utsav

  • November to March
  • Peak season: Full Moon Nights & New Year / Christmas

Tips for Delhi Travelers

  • Book your tent accommodation early (high demand).
  • Carry warm clothes (desert nights are cold).
  • Keep your ID proof handy for entry.
  • Prefer flights if traveling with kids or seniors.
